WebThe three roots are: 2, −3, 3. Again, since x − 3 is a factor of P ( x ), the remainder is 0. Problem 5. Sketch the graph of this polynomial, y = x3 − 2 x2 − 5 x + 6, given that one root is −2. Since −2 is a root, then ( x + 2) is a factor. To find the other, quadratic factor, divide the polynomial by x + 2. WebJul 22, 2016 · There are formulas for the roots of a quadratic, cubic or quartic in terms of radicals, but not (in general) for the roots of a polynomial of degree 5 or higher. For example, the roots of x 5 + 2 x + 1 can't be written in terms of radicals. WebIf you want to find roots in a given interval, check Sturm's theorem. A more general (complex) algorithm for generic polynomial solving is Jenkins-Traub algorithm. This is clearly overkill here, but it works well on cubics. Usually, you use a third-party implementation. Since you do C, using the GSL is surely your best bet. Learn more about complex functions, calculus, functions, roots, inequalities MATLAB Given the quadratic function in , I want to know under what conditions for a and b, all … WebMar 24, 2024 · The cubic formula is the closed-form solution for a cubic equation, i.e., the roots of a cubic polynomial. A general cubic equation is of the form z^3+a_2z^2+a_1z+a_0=0 (1) (the coefficient a_3 of z^3 may be taken as 1 without loss of generality by dividing the entire equation through by a_3).
